H-1B sponsorship profile: The University of Texas Health Center at Tyler. Across U.S. Department of Labor LCA disclosures, The University of Texas Health Center at Tyler filed 25 Labor Condition Applications covering 25 H-1B worker positions between fiscal year 2023 and fiscal year 2025. The employer’s DOL certification rate sits at 100% (25 certified of 25 filed), a useful proxy for how cleanly their prevailing-wage attestations pass the Labor Department’s preliminary review before USCIS adjudication.
Compensation spread. Offered wages on The University of Texas Health Center at Tyler’s H-1B petitions range from $35,006 at the low end to $450,000 at the high end, with a petition-weighted average of $142,061. That range reflects the mix of occupations the company sponsors, led by Research Associate (4 petitions at $42,908 avg), followed by Research Associate and Postdoctoral Research Associate, Sr.. H-1B salaries reported on LCAs must meet or exceed the DOL prevailing wage for the role and worksite, so the spread also tracks wage-level geography and seniority.
Geographic footprint. The University of Texas Health Center at Tyler is headquartered in Tyler, TX under NAICS code 611310, and places H-1B workers across 1 state, most heavily in TX. Combined, these signals give a granular view of how one employer uses the H-1B program, volume, approval cleanliness, wage posture, and where the jobs actually sit on the map.
